We start off with VERY loud CM Punk chants, and a big pop for him when he comes out.

CM PUNK PROMO- AWESOME!
He was quite unapologetic. In terms of storylines, the important note was that he had a bag with him and talked about how important the thing in it was. It seems clear that it’s the old title belt which he never lost… but if that’s the case, why didn’t he just reveal that?

AEW TNT TITLE MATCH: Wardlow(c) vs. Luchasaurus (w/Christian Cage)- 6.75/10
This was an okay big-man match. Luchasaurus won after a lot of interference from Christian. That’s the sixth change for this title so far this year. I’m also not crazy about Luchasaurus as a champion. He’s fine as someone’s heavy, either as a babyface or a heel, but I think Christian will always be the real focus of this act, so I worry about putting the title on the guy who isn’t currently the focus and never will be.

ANDRADE EL IDOLO vs. BUDDY MATTHEWS (w/Julia Hart)- 7.75/10
Apparently Buddy Matthews recently returned from some kind of injury. Has this even been mentioned before?
The story of this match was both men having the injuries that they are retuning from worked over. In Matthews’ case, this was his knee, so Andrade won with a Figure Eight, and thus Charlotte Flair sent a message to Rhea Ripley.

POST-MATCH SEGMENT- meh
Andrade is a total babyface now. I had a feeling that was coming when his heel manager was mysteriously absent from ringside (and the announcers made no mention of it). After the match, he tried to help Matthews up, but Matthews pushed him off. Andrade offered a handshake, but the lights went out and the House of Black magically teleported into the ring. Brody King beat up Andrade. Then they lights went out again, and… we don’t know what happened, because the director decided to cut to a video package instead of stay on the ring. How did the director know that this was the House of Black leaving as opposed to, say, Sting teleporting in to make the save?

SKYE BLUE & WILLOW NIGHTENGALE vs. THE OUTCASTS (Toni Storm & Ruby Riott)- 5.75/10
The heels jumped the bell on the babyfaces. The heels got in the face of a fan at ringside, who slapped both of them. Oh. It’s Skye Blue’s mom… which means they did the same thing in this match that they did on Wednesday.
This was standard babyface in peril stuff with a bad finish that saw the heels try to cheat right in front of the referee and the referee make no effort to stop them, because the planned finish involving the babyfaces winning because they managed to make said cheating backfire. There must have been about five better ways to get to this same finish, and they picked the laziest one. Skye Blue pinning Ruby does nothing for me. I have no interested in seeing this undercard loser built up for yet another title shot that everyone knows she has no chance of winning.

CM PUNK & FTR vs. SAMOA JOE & BULLET CLUB GOLD- 8/10
Jim Ross joined the commentary team for this match.
I popped so huge for Punk getting that headlock on Joe. This was a big, long, tag match. It was exciting, but I don’t feel like we learned anything here, either about the direction they’re going to go in or about what might make Collision different from Dynamite or anything like that. In fact, that’s my real takeaway from this whole show. It was pretty good, but it didn’t feel any different.
